#b229f1 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#b229f1 is composed of 69.8% red, 16.1% green and 94.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 26.1% cyan, 83% magenta, 0% yellow and 5.5% black. It has a hue angle of 281.1 degrees, a saturation of 87.7% and a lightness of 55.3%. #b229f1 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ff52ff with #6500e3. Closest websafe color is: #9933ff.

● #b229f1 color description : Bright violet.
The hexadecimal color #b229f1 has RGB values of R:178, G:41, B:241 and CMYK values of C:0.26, M:0.83, Y:0,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 11676145.
